Terry Carr (1937–1987) was among the most influential editors in science fiction, his ‘Best of the Year’ anthologies and the revived Ace Science Fiction Specials introduced or elevated writers like William Gibson (Neuromancer appeared in the line) and Kim Stanley Robinson. A Hugo-winning editor and a fine writer himself, he had an unerring eye for the genre’s future.
